- What to Bring: Please wear comfortable hiking clothing and sturdy walking or hiking shoes with good grip. We also recommend bringing a small backpack with at least 1 litre of water per person, snacks, sunscreen, sunglasses, and a hat. As El Torcal de Antequera is located at over 1,200 metres (3,940 ft) above sea level, weather conditions can change quickly. During spring, autumn, and winter, temperatures are often significantly cooler than at lower elevations, so it is essential to bring warm clothing, such as a fleece or insulated jacket, and a waterproof layer in case of wind or rain. Choosing the right clothing according to the season will help ensure a safe and comfortable hiking experience.
